Description
- The present application claims priority to U.S. Provisional Application No. 61/363,350, filed Jul. 12, 2010, the contents of which are incorporated herein by reference in its entirety.
- 1. Field of the Invention
- The present invention relates to a template which holds the nail coverings to be applied to the fingers and toes of a person. More specifically, the template contains the nail coverings for both the fingers and toes.
- 2. Description of the Related Art
- Templates are used in the nail industry to hold the nail coverings to be applied to the fingers and toes of a person. Generally, one template is used to provide the nail coverings for the fingers, and another for the toes of a person. Thus, two different nail templates need to be stocked and accounted for in inventory.
- For example, U.S. 2005/0061342 describes a plastic element having an area and shape approximating the area and shape of a nail. The element has an adhesive backing A plurality of the elements can be in contact with one release backing sheet. The elements can be of different sizes, but the elements are each individually designed for fingers or toes.
- U.S. 2005/0150508 describes nail-art systems for fingernail or toenail decoration. The nail-art nail system described comprises flexible, computer-printed nail-art appliqués used to decorate fingernails or toenails. Separate templates for fingernails and toenails would still need to be stocked.
- Providing a template which contains the nail coverings for both the fingers and toes, however, would be of great benefit to the industry. The benefits would be realized both in the inventory of the product, but also in the overall ease of application of the product.
- Provided is a template which contains the nail coverings for both the fingers and toes in the one template. Such a template provides a very important advantage. Only one template needs to be stocked as compared to one for fingers and one for toes. Only one template needs to be accounted for in inventory. Customers can get two uses out of a single template. Ease of application to the fingers and toes of a person would be greatly enhanced.
- Among other factors, it has been discovered that great benefits are achieved by combining the nail coverings for both the toes and fingers on a single template. In particular, such benefits are enhanced when each nail covering on the template is structured to be useful for both a finger and a toe. Application to the fingers and toes can be accomplished by using a single template of nail coverings. Moreover, by having a single item or section of the template designed to cover both a fingernail and toenail, application to both the fingers and toes can be accomplished more easily, and the nail coverings can be accounted for and maintained more easily. From a business perspective, having a single template cover both the fingers and toes, eliminates by half the number of templates that are needed to stock and account for in inventory.
- The FIGURE of the Drawing depicts a template with ten sections or nail coverings, with each nail covering being appropriate for both a finger and a toe.
- The template contains the materials to be applied to the nails, but each section in the template can be used for a finger nail and a toe nail. The section is sufficiently long that when cut in two, at the desired location, one side is used for a finger nail and the other for a toe nail. One side of the material in the template is designed or shaped for the finger, generally the more rounded side, and the other is designed or shaped for toes. The template will generally have ten sections or nail coverings, with the material for application in each section being applicable for a finger nail and a toe nail. The section or nail covering is sufficient in length to allow such dual application when cut at the appropriate location, with one side designed for application to a finger, and the other to a toe.
- In reference to the FIGURE of the Drawing, a
template 1 is shown with ten sections. However, a template may accommodate as many sections for nail coverings as desired. Each section has oneside 2 useful for application to fingers, and asecond side 3 designed for application to toes. In one embodiment, the side of the template sections designed forfinger nail application 2 is more rounded than the sides of the section designed for application to the toe nails. When a section of material is removed from the template in preparation for application, the section can be cut at an appropriate location, which can be indicated on the section, to create nail material for application to a finger nail and a toenail. The appropriate location can be indicated, for example, by a line 4 on the nail covering material. Shown 4 is a dotted line, but the line need not be dotted. - Each section of material or item on the template is of a shape and area approximating the shape and area of a particular finger nail on one side of the item, and of a shape and area approximating the shape and area of a particular toe nail on the other side. The length of the section or item is designed to be of sufficient length to accommodate both the fingernail covering and the toe nail covering. The covering, once removed from the template, can be cut to accommodate and provide both a fingernail covering and a toe nail covering.
- The nail coverings can be made of any suitable material. The nail covering can be made of a single layer of material, or can be a laminate of several layers of material. The materials can contain graphics or can be clear. In one embodiment, the nail covering is comprised of a laminate of cast vinyl films. The films can have graphics within the film or on the film. Graphics can be added after application of the nail coverings to the nail, if desired. The top layer of the laminate can be a clear protective layer for the graphics. A single cast vinyl film or a combination of cast vinyl films are preferred. Films such as graphic films, self-adhesive films, polyester, latex and rubber films are examples of other suitable films that can be used. The nail covering material can be any suitable, conventional nail covering material, of any desired thickness or complexity.
- The sections or items on the template have an adhesive backing for easy application to the finger and toe nail. The adhesive is dry and adheres to a nail upon contact, firmly securing the nail covering to the nail. The application of the nail, and its detailed shaping, can be accomplished in any method known to the industry. For example, one method is disclosed in U.S. Pat. No. 7,861,730, the contents of which are incorporated herein by reference in its entirety. The adhesive used, however, generally releases easily and completely, so that the nail covering can be peeled away from the nail, leaving no adhesive behind. The adhesive is also non-damaging to the nail, and is resistant to most oils, solvents, acids, alkalines, soaps and salts. Any suitable conventional adhesive can be so used. For example, a clear, solvent based acrylic adhesive would be suitable.
- The template from which the various nail coverings with adhesive backing are removed can be any suitable backing from which the coverings are easily peeled. One example of a suitable backing is a silicon coated release paper.
- The various nail coverings can be of different colors or designs, and can vary in size to accommodate many different people. Only one template is needed, however, to beautifully attire the fingernails and toenails of a particular person.
- The template can be packaged and sold individually, or can be part of a kit containing other components. Such components can include an emery board, alcohol wipes, or a system for heating and applying the nail coverings. The nail template can be one component of the kit.
- The present templates offer many benefits. By having a single item or section of the template designed to cover both a fingernail and a toe nail, application to both the fingers and toes can be accomplished more easily, and the appropriate nail coverings can be accounted for and maintained more easily. The single template also greatly reduces inventory and accounting issues.

Claims (14)
1. A template containing nail coverings for application to both fingernails and toenails, with each nail covering having one end shaped to accommodate a fingernail and the other end shaped to accommodate a toenail.
2. The template of claim 1 , containing ten sections of material for application to both fingernails and toenails, with each section having one end shaped for application to fingernails and the other end shaped for application to toenails.
3. The template of claim 1 , wherein the end shaped for application to fingernails is more rounded than the other end shaped for application to toenails.
4. The template of claim 2 , wherein the end shaped for application to fingernails is more rounded than the other end shaped for application to toenails.
5. The template of claim 1 , wherein the nail coverings on the template have an adhesive backing.
6. The template of claim 5 , wherein the adhesive backing is comprised of an acrylic adhesive.
7. The template of claim 1 , wherein the template containing the nail coverings is comprised of silicon treated release paper.
8. The template of claim 1 , wherein the nail coverings are comprised of at least one layer of a cast vinyl material.
9. The template of claim 8 , wherein the nail coverings are comprised of multiple cast vinyl layers.
10. The template of claim 1 , wherein the nail coverings have a line on them indicating the place the covering should be cut to provide a fingernail covering and a toenail covering.
11. The template of claim 10 , wherein the line is a dotted line.
12. A kit comprising the template of claim 1 .
13. The kit of claim 12 comprising components for heating and applying the nail covering to the nail.
14. The template of claim 1 , containing greater than ten sections of nail coverings for application to both fingernails and toenails.
